Ivaylo Donchev
Currently working as Technical team lead in HackSoft in Bulgaria.
A programmer for ~7 years, working with Python and DJango for 6 years.
Speaker at EuroPython 2018 and PyCon Balkan 2018.
Session
07-14
11:55
45min
Async Django
Ivaylo Donchev
Python has a full set of tools for asynchronous programming - multiprocessing, multithreading, coroutines, etc. And Django uses most of them.
Since Django 3, we have the ability to create fully async non-blocking Django views that could handle thousands of requests concurrently.
In this talk, we'll focus on 2 key topics:
1. The motivation and the decisions behind the Django async support
2. Choosing the right tools to make our views async and efficient
Django
Wicklow Hall 1